Workforce Development and Education Support Committee

CNMA's Workforce Development and Education Support Committee focuses on building, diversifying, and retaining the CNM workforce in California.  This includes strategizing to increase the number of clinical placement sites and preceptors in California, establishing and maintaining two-way communication between midwifery programs that have student nurse-midwives in California and the CNMA Board of Directors, fostering and supporting student mentoring programs, and seeking ways to support and retain midwives in practice.

 

Ideal candidates for this committee include any of the following:

  • Lead and Chief Midwives from practices throughout the state 

  • At least one representative from each midwifery program that has student midwives in California

  • Midwives who are passionate about supporting students and educators

  • Midwives who are passionate about mentoring 

  • Midwives who are passionate about scaling up midwifery in California

  • Midwives who seek to enhance the well-being of midwives in practice
